[PATCH] GNU/kOpenSolaris port

2008-12-21 Thread Robert Millan
Hi, I ported libtool to GNU/kOpenSolaris [1]. Because the checks are always the same for all Glibc-based systems, and having to wait for libtool to propagate to every package out there is a PITA, I propose using a generic '*-gnu' match. Attached is a patch for libtool (with ChangeLog entry)
